The Proxmox with native ZFS guide doesn't have any tamper protection anyways, so it is not the end of the world without these. However, it will be good practice to

  • Not setup LetsEncrypt until the ZFS root dataset is already encrypted
  • Rotate the server SSH keys after the dataset is encrypted
  • Change the root password (just generally good practice to not expose the hash of the root practice I suppose)
